Work Experience: The bidder should have satisfactorily completed* in the last three previous financial years and the current financial year up to the date of opening of the tender, one similar single service contract** for a minimum of 35% of advertised value of the bid.
*Completed service contract includes on-going service contract subject to payment of bills amounting to at least 35% of the advertised value of the bid.
Similar nature of work defined as:OEM/Authorized dealer for carrying out Comprehensive or Non-Comprehensive Annual Maintenance Contract of Air Compressors of Minimum Capacity -300 CFM and working air pressure 10 Kg/CM2 in any Zonal Railway or Central Government Organization or State Government Organization or Public Sector undertaking. O R Experience in carrying out Comprehensive or Non- Comprehensive Annual Maintenance Contract of Air Compressors of Minimum Capacity-300 CFM and Working air pressure 10 Kg/CM2 in any Zonal Railway or Central government organization or State Government Organization or Public Sector undertaking.
Work experience certificate from private individual shall not be accepted. Certificate from public listed company/private company/Trusts having annual turnover of Rs 500 Crore and above subject to the same being issued from their Head office by a person of the company duly enclosing his authorization by the Management for issuing such credentials.
Notes: The bidder shall submit details of work executed by them in the prescribed format along with bid for the service contracts to be considered for qualification of work experience criteria clearly indicating the nature/scope of contract, actual completion cost and actual date of completion for such contract.
Financial Standing: The Bidders will be qualified only if they have minimum financial capabilities as below -
T1- Financial Turnover: The bidder should have an aggregate financial turnover not less than 1.5 times the advertised Bid value during the last three previous financial years and in the current financial year up to the date of opening of the tender. The audited balance sheet reflecting financial turnover certified by chartered accountant with her stamp, signature and membership number shall be considered.The tenderers shall submit the Certificate of Contractual Receipts as per Annexure-D, along with copies of Audited Balance Sheets duly certified by the Chartered Accountant/ Certificate from Chartered Accountant duly supported by Audited Balance Sheet.
T2-Liquidity: The bidder should have access to or has available liquid assets, lines of credit and other financial means to meet cash flow that is valued at 5% of the estimated bid value net of applicant's commitments for other contracts. The audited balance sheet and/or banking reference certified by chartered accountant with her stamp, signature and membership number shall be submitted by the bidder along with bid.
Banking reference should contain in clear terms the amount that bank will be in a position to lend for this work to the applicant/member of the Joint Venture/Consortium. In case the Net Current Assets (as seen from the Balance Sheets) are negative, only the Banking references will be considered. Otherwise the aggregate of the Net Current Assets and submitted Banking references will be considered for working out the Liquidity.The banking reference should be from a Scheduled Bank in India and it should not be more than 3 months old as on date of submission of bids.In Case of JV firms overall liquidity of JV firm shall be assessed by arithmetic sum of liquidity of all members of JV.The tenderers shall submit the Banking Reference for Liquidity Bank Certificate as per Annexure-E.
Bid Evaluation System:Two Bid Systems / Two Packet System: This method of evaluation shall be used for all service contracts having bid value exceeding Rs 50 Lakh. The procedure detailed below shall be adopted for dealing with 'Two Packets System' of Bidding:With a view to assess the bids technically without being influenced by the financial bids, 'Two Packets System of Bidding' shall be adopted.The first Bid shall be with the objective of scrutinizing the capability, financial strength, experience etc. of the bidders. If the technical offers are found acceptable by meeting the minimum qualifying marks as provided in the technical criteria, the second Bid shall be opened the bids shall be processed for finalization in the normal manner (eligible lowest bidder).Those bidders who do not meet this criterion shall not be considered for opening their financial bids.However, if on the basis of information contained in the first packet, the Tender Committee needs clarification regarding processes, specifications etc.; communication can be initiated with the bidders, In seeking clarifications; all communications with bidders shall be properly recorded so that an adult trail is maintained. Clarifications shall be confined to the documents/information already submitted by the bidder.
